Record high on memory price surge
Samsung Electronics hit a record high with foreign net buying, supported by the memory upcycle. The speaker highlights that Apple's LPDDR price negotiation was completed at over +80% for Samsung, sharply improving the memory earnings outlook, and Samsung is also a key Korean HBM supplier benefiting from big tech custom AI chips.
Multiple AI memory catalysts
SK hynix hit a record high with multiple catalysts: Citi raised its target price to 1.4 million KRW and projected 2026 operating profit of 150 trillion KRW; the company is reviewing a US AI investment corporation of about 10 trillion KRW; Apple's LPDDR negotiation was completed at over +100%; and Microsoft's Maia 200 accelerator is reportedly using SK hynix HBM3 exclusively. Big tech custom AI chips should continue to expand HBM demand.

Governance reform supports long-term Korea rally
The speaker compares the current Korean market to the 1985-1989 liberalization and upgrade period, arguing that governance reform and value-up efforts could stabilize the market and create a rare long-term opportunity to build assets in Korean equities. Short-term surges will not persist, but the foundation for long-term investing is being laid.
Maia 200 boosts AI efficiency
Microsoft unveiled its in-house Maia 200 AI accelerator, which is used in its AI services and reportedly delivers 30% better performance than prior hardware and higher performance than Amazon and Google TPUs. The speaker sees it as an important but underappreciated positive for Microsoft's AI cost efficiency and infrastructure economics.

Korea stablecoin regulation opening
Samsung is reviewing a stake in Dunamu, partnering with Coinbase to expand Samsung Pay crypto payments, and working with financial groups on a won stablecoin issuance and payment system. Korean regulators are considering allowing domestic corporate coin issuance. The speaker says the trend is clearly changing and could become a major market issue, with banks and financial companies likely to be busy.
AI commercialization expands into physical robots
AI is moving from data-center infrastructure to commercialization and daily-life services. A physical AI demonstration showed robot collaboration in auto-parts manufacturing cut costs by 75-80%, Nike is expanding logistics automation, and NVIDIA's AI weather model proved predictive capability. The speaker says the physical AI theme has strong expansion potential and investors should keep monitoring it.
